IE fatter hat af min css.

Tags:    html css

Hej alle sammen, jeg er ved at bygge hjemmesiden www.brugtitudstyr.dk op i css. Pt. virker det fint i Firefox, men i Internet Explorer ligner det crap.
Har prøvet lidt forskelligt, men kan ikke få det til at virke, og vil virkelig gerne undgå, at skulle bruge tabeller.

Min HTML kode:
Fold kodeboks ind/udKode 


Min CSS kode
Fold kodeboks ind/udKode 


Håber I kan hjælpe mig!!!



5 svar postet i denne tråd vises herunder
1 indlæg har modtaget i alt 2 karma
Sorter efter stemmer Sorter efter dato
Jeg tror Niklas mente det ironisk :)

Du bruger godt nok css, men du anvender slet ikke hele teorien omkring semantisk opbygning af en hjemmeside, hvilket er hele fordelen.

I stedet for at lave siden efter formen
indhold -> layout
kan man lave den som
indhold -> struktur -> layout

Når google skal finde søgeresultater, forsøger den at finde ud af hvor godt de enkelte sider passer til søgeordet. De sider der får flest point, kommer øverst i søgeresultaterne. Her er et meget simplificeret eksempel:

Lad os nu sige, at du havde bygget en hjemmeside op i tabeller. Så ville Google give din side et point for hver gang søgeordet forekom på siden, fordi den ikke kan se, hvor centralt ordet er på siden.

Havde du derimod opbygget siden semantisk, ville Google fx give et point for hver gang søgeordet optrådte i den almindelige tekst, to point for hver gang ordet optrådte i en fremhævet tekst, og fem point for hver gang ordet fremkom i en overskrift, og siden ville derfor komme højere i resultaterne.

Det er altså ikke hvorvidt siden bruger css eller ej, der gør forskellen, menderimod om den er semantisk eller ej. Det er dog meget svært, hvis ikke umuligt at lave en side semantisk uden brug af css.

IE er ikke så god til CSS endnu. CSS har også kun været her siden 1998, så man må jo lige give dem lidt tid til at implementere det :)

Helt specifikt er det følgende, som IE ikke forstår:

display: table-cell;

Du må finde et alternativ til denne property, som IE forstår.



Indlæg senest redigeret d. 18.10.2006 18:54 af Bruger #3143
Hvorfor vil du da undgå at bruge tabeller? Dette er da guds gave til folket :D



Har læst noget om, at google har nogle problemer med at hive data'er ud af dem.
Og siden skal være så meget SEO som muligt...



Mener IE 7 kan understøtte det :)



Nop gør det ikke, men har lavet det igen fra bunden, så nu virker det det. Giver halv delen af pointene til Jesper, fordi han lærte mig noget om css, men desværre ikke direkte med mit problem.



t